The Role of a Car Locksmith
A car locksmith concentrates on supplying security services for automobiles, including key replacement, lock installation, and emergency situation lockout assistance. Unlike a general locksmith who works with a variety of locks, an automotive locksmith focuses solely on the detailed systems found in automobiles, trucks, and other cars. These experts are equipped with the current tools and technology to deal with a large range of automotive security requirements.
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Replacement and Duplication
Lost or Stolen Keys: If you've misplaced your keys or they have been stolen, a car locksmith can supply a new set. They use specific devices to produce exact duplicates of your original keys.Broken Keys: Sometimes, keys break inside the lock, making it impossible to eliminate them. A professional locksmith can extract the broken key and develop a brand-new one.
Keyless Entry and Ignition Systems
Programing Key Fobs: Modern vehicles often come with keyless entry systems. A car locksmith can program and replace key fobs, ensuring that your vehicle's electronic elements operate seamlessly.Ignition Interlock Devices: For motorists with a history of DUI, ignition interlock gadgets are often mandated by law. A car locksmith can set up and maintain these gadgets.
Lock Installation and Repair
New Locks: If your vehicle's locks are harmed or malfunctioning, a car locksmith can install brand-new ones.Lock Repair: Rather than replacing locks, a locksmith can frequently repair them, conserving you money and time.
Emergency Lockout Assistance
24/7 Service: Being locked out of your car can occur at any time. Many car locksmiths offer 24/7 emergency services to help you return on the road rapidly.Expert Tools: They use specialized tools to unlock your vehicle without causing damage, which is especially crucial for more recent designs with complex security systems.
High-Security Locks and Keys
Transponder Keys: These keys contain a chip that interacts with the car's computer system. A car locksmith can program and replace these keys.Laser-Cut Keys: Some high-end vehicles utilize laser-cut keys for enhanced security. Q: How do I know if a car locksmith is legitimate?
A: A legitimate car locksmith near me cheap locksmith will be accredited, bonded, and guaranteed. They must also have the ability to provide evidence of ownership before performing any services. In addition, check for favorable reviews and a good track record in the neighborhood.
Q: Can a car locksmith for a car near me make a key for a vehicle without the initial?
A: Yes, a professional car locksmith can develop a brand-new key even if you don't have the original. However, they will require the vehicle's make, design, and often the VIN to guarantee the key is appropriate.
Q: How long does it take to replace a car key?
A: The time it takes to replace a car key can differ depending upon the complexity of the lock and the kind of key. Simple key duplications can take simply a couple of minutes, while more intricate jobs like programming transponder keys may take an hour or more.
Q: Will a car locksmith damage my vehicle when unlocking it?
A: A professional car locksmith will utilize non-invasive methods to unlock your vehicle, minimizing the danger of damage. However, if a key is stuck in the lock, some minor damage might be inevitable.
Q: Can a car locksmith bypass the ignition system?
A: While a competent car locksmith can bypass the ignition system to open your car, they will refrain from doing so unless you can prove ownership of the vehicle. Bypassing the ignition system without proper authorization is unlawful.
